Discover the Best Resources that Makes Your Website - Secure, Fast & Beautiful.

If you are starting a new website for blog, eCommerce, startup or already own one, then you got to focus on four essential elements for successful online business.

  • Performance
  • Security
  • SEO
  • Design

In the last four years, I've tested hundreds of products and not all works as expected.

Considering the large number of ​available options, it might be challenging to pick the best product for your online business.

Let's see the following which I am using or have used and found the best in the industry.

Web Hosting & Domain Registration

One of the first thing you need to get your website online is buying domain and web hosting. This is essential as hosting play major role in overall website availability, performance & security.

There are multiple types of hosting available but mainly the following.

  • Shared Hosting
  • Cloud/VPS Hosting

If you are beginner then best bet is go for shared hosting as you don't need to worry about managing server and software.

For better performance and higher control on server, you may go for cloud/VPS hosting. Here everything from OS to software is managed by you. Best bet if you are expecting high traffic at lower server cost.


Site Ground

Best for shared hosting

When you are starting as a beginner, you want to focus more on your core business instead of dealing with hosting issue.

Site Ground is probably one of the best shared hosting provider to let you host any type of site including WordPress, Joomla, Magento, eCommerce, Static, etc. with rock solid latest technology & features. 

Site Ground data center is located in three continents so choose to host close to your visitors. 

  • Chicago, US - For North/South America, Africa
  • London, UK -  For Europe, Russia
  • Amsterdam, NL - For Europe, Russia
  • Milan, IT - For Italy, Europe
  • Singapore, SG - For Australia, Asia
  • Free Cloud flare CDN, SSL, Security, HTTP/2, Domain
  • SSD on all hosting plan
  • 30 days money back guarantee
  • cPanel, SSH, Backup


Best for VPS hosting

When you need to optimise your website for high traffic and better performance, you need the complete control on the server.

Linode give you high-performance VM server with root access where you can install the desired OS and packages.

You get 1 GB RAM, 1 CPU, 20 GB SSD, 1 TB transfer at $5 per month.

  • Intel E5 Processors
  • IPv6 Support
  • Rescue Mode, Cloning, Images
  • DNS Manager, Backup, Scaling, Load Balancer

Google Cloud Platform

Best for Cloud hosting

A true high-performance, scalable platform where you can host small to enterprise level of applications. 

Google Cloud is latecomer to enter the cloud market but it has already gained the significant market share and provide various services.

  • Compute, Management/Developer Tools
  • Storage & Databases
  • Networking, Security
  • Big Data, Machine Learning

Google recently announced FREE tier program to help you learn and build the application.



Best for Domain Registration

If you intend to host your website on shared hosting then you can get the domain registration with them in FREE. 

However, if you wish to host on Cloud or register a domain separately then you may consider Namecheap.

You can register your domain starting from $0.88

Website Platform & Framework

Once you're ready with the domain and hosting, you need a platform where you can build your website.

It really depends on the requirement for choosing the platform from like:

  • PHP, CMS
  • Node.js, Python, .Net
  • HTML 5, Static

However, if you are just targeting the blogging, startup, corporate, personal or simple shopping site then you may choose either WordPress or Joomla.



Best for blogging

WordPress is open source software with market share of more than 58% in CMS.

You can create beautiful website in minutes with help of WordPress. There are large number of FREE themes and plugins to get you started.

WordPress is SEO friendly, mobile responsive, easy to learn & manage



Best for blogging, web applications

Joomla is loved by millions. A free CMS let you build almost any type of website quickly.

Joomla is  SEO/Mobile friendly, multilingual, multi-level permissions & developer friendly. 

More than 10,000 templates and extensions are available to speed-up the website design & development process.


Genesis - WordPress Framework

Best Developer-friendly WordPress Framework

Genesis by StudioPress is one of the light-weight framework loved by more than 200,000 customers.

There are hundreds of Genesis child theme available to quickly build your website. Some of the features are:

  • Theme customiser/options
  • SEO-ready, mobile-friendly, accessibility ready
  • HTML 5, Schema integration
  • Custom header, menu, background, page templates

Security, WAF, CDN & Performance

The top most critical elements of your website - Security & Performance!

It's essential to ensure your website load faster and secure from online vulnerabilities. Fast loading website not only rank higher in search engine but also  convert more. 



Best for WebSite Security, WAF

SUCURI is a cloud-based security provider, help you to protect your website from online threats and keep hacker away.

SUCURI WAF (Web Application Firewall) runs on Global Anycast CDN (Content Delivery Network) to boost the site performance.

SUCURI provide complete  security solution to any type website platform including WordPress, Joomla, Drupal, Magento, etc.

  • Malware detection/removal, Security monitoring
  • DDoS/Brute Force/Bad bots/SPAM  Protection
  • OWASP Top 10 protection
  • HTTP/2, Caching, IPv6
  • Free SSL Certificate
  • 30-days money back


Best for Performance Optimisation, CDN

Cloudflare is used by more than 2 million websites to super charge & secure the site.

You can get it started in FREE. Cloudflare has POP (points of presence) in 102 data center worldwide which make your site load faster globally.

Thanks to its Rocket Loader, Free Universal SSL Cert, caching, Web Sockets, DNSSEC, etc.


SSL Store

Best for Buying SSL Certificates

SUCURI, SiteGround, Cloudflare provide you free SSL certificate which should be ok for personal blog, website.

However, if you are running eCommerce or sensitive information transaction based site then you may want to get one from reputed  brand like:

  • Symantec
  • GeoTrust
  • RapidSSL
  • Thawte
  • Comodo

You can either get it from their website or buy from SSL Store at cheaper price. Starting price $10.99/year

  • Lowest price guarantee
  • 30-days money back

Email, Landing Page, Lead Generation

Once you've secured your site, you can think of how you deal with site email, how to let people join your newsletter and create an attractive landing page.

if you are using shared hosting then you don't need to worry about email as hosting provider will take care of email system.


Gmail for Business

Best for Sending & Receiving Emails

You like Gmail for your personal use? Why not use Gmail for your business too?

G Suite, powered by Google Cloud help you get business email for your domain. 

You don't have to worry about SPAM, security risk as  email delivery is protected by Google Infrastructure. Get 20% off with the following coupon code.


Thrive Landing & Leads

Best for WordPress Landing Page & Leads

Thrive Theme provides one of the best cost-effective conversion focused solutions.

You can create beautiful landing page in minutes without slowing down your website.

Thrive Leads let you create almost all types of opt-in form to collect the emails. 

  • Sticky, in-line, 2-step, slide-in, content lock, sidebar, screen filler, scroll mat, popup 
  • Animation, trigger options, Smart Exit, A/B testing
  • Asset delivery, Advanced targeting, report
  • 30-day money back

Monitoring, Analytics & Vulnerability Scan

After setting up your online business, you don't want to miss the monitoring and security scan.

By adding monitoring & scanning, you know the first when your website goes down or vulnerable.


Happy Apps

Best for Website Uptime Monitoring

Get your site uptime monitored in FREE with Happy Apps.

You can configure to get notified by email or SMS.

Happy Apps got beautiful dashboard to show you the following.

  • Availability
  • Response time
  • Incident details

Google Analytics

Best for Analytics

Monitor how your website reach to the audience, number of page views you get, source of traffic and many more with Google Analytics.

Once you start getting traffic, it's essential to monitor your website analytics data so you know what content perform better.

Google Analytics is free and loved by millions of website owners.



Best for Continuous Security

Performing regular security against your website is important so you don't miss out any new discovered bug and being hacked.

Detectify automate the security scan and notify you for any finding. Detectify analyse for more than 500 vulnerabilities including OWASP top 10.

I hope above gives you an idea about various tools usage for creating better, faster & secure website.